About This Book

What if your hair had a personality all its own? Imagine a wild crown full of curls and coils that bounce and twist every which way, making every day an adventure. Can one girl learn to love her hair, no matter what surprises it brings?

Quick Assessment

Hair-Larious is a heartwarming story that celebrates self-confidence and the uniqueness of natural hair. Geared toward ages 4-8, it gently explores themes of self-acceptance and embracing differences through the playful experiences of a young girl and her lively hair. Parents can expect a positive, uplifting message suitable for early elementary readers.
